The 2015–16 Towson Tigers women's basketball team represents Towson University during the 2015–16 NCAA Division I women's basketball season. The Tigers, led by third year head coach , play their home games at SECU Arena and were members of the Colonial Athletic Association. They finished the season 7–24, 3–15 CAA play to finish in a tie for ninth place. They advanced to the quarterfinals of the CAA Women's Tournament where they lost to Drexel.
